Considering that your roof is constantly subjected to the outside elements, it means your roof is going to diminish over time. The speed at which it breaks down will depend on a variety of factors. Those include; the grade of the initial components used and the craftsmanship, the level of abuse it will have to take from the weather, how well the roof is taken care of and the style of the roof. Most roofing professionals will estimate around 20 years for a well-built and well-maintained roof, but obviously that can never be guaranteed because of the above issues. Our suggestion is to always keep your roof well maintained and get regular checkups to be sure it lasts as long as possible.
You should never pressure-wash your roof, as you take the risk of taking off any covering materials that have been added to offer protection from the elements. Furthermore, you should keep away from chlorine-based bleach cleaners since they could also reduce the lifespan of your roof. When you converse with your roof cleaning specialist, tell them to use an EPA-approved algaecide/fungicide to clean your roof. That will remove the ugly algae and discoloration without ruining the tile or shingles.

Libertytown is an unincorporated community and census-designated place (CDP) in Frederick County, in the U.S. state of Maryland.[2] As of the 2010 census it had a population of 950.[3] The Abraham Jones House was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 1973.[4]
The community is in eastern Frederick County, along Maryland Route 26 (Liberty Road), which leads east 34 miles (55 km) to Baltimore and southwest 11 miles (18 km) to Frederick. Maryland Route 75 crosses MD 26 in the center of town, leading northeast 8 miles (13 km) to Union Bridge and south 7 miles (11 km) to New Market. Maryland Route 31 intersects MD 26 on the east edge of town and leads northeast 17 miles (27 km) to Westminster. Maryland Route 550 leaves MD 26 in the western part of town and leads northwest 5 miles (8 km) to Woodsboro.

Liquid used membrane systems require rigorous preparation of the substrate, which must be dry and dust-free with patched fractures. While liquid applied finishes are extremely flexible, self-flashing and easily used to contoured surfaces, they have low permeability and need uniform thickness. Low slope structural metal roofing is typically called standing seam roof and includes interlocking panels that run vertically along the roofing system surface.

Some metal roofing utilized on low slope applications requires machine seaming throughout setup to make sure a leak-proof seal. A seaming device is merely rolled along the panels to crimp the panel joints together. A standing seam style guarantees sufficient draining pipes from rain and snow, effectively eliminating ponding, leakages and related issues.

This may result in a longer life expectancy and low annual operating expense. In retrofit projects, a sub-framing system is attached to the existing flat roof surface area to provide a minimum:12 roofing pitch. Alternatives for the restoration of a metal roofing system surface area include acrylic coverings made of polymers that cure to form a resilient, constant elastomeric membrane over the surface of the metal roofing system and can be contributed to metal roofing systems to resolve your structure’s specific requirements around waterproofing, rust and UV protection.
Acrylic finishings are water-based, non-flammable and emit no harmful fumes. These systems can endure the most common types of roofing threats, consisting of ultraviolet light, temperature level extremes, mildew, typical foot traffic and structure movement.
